The work that Concern Worldwide is doing in Zambia is nothing short of amazing.
To come here and see first hand the fruits of the work is breathtaking.
Most of the Concern work done in Zambia is suported by Irish Aid. The Kerry Group and Accenture also are major donors.
It would be impossible to see this work and not be proud of the Irish people for supporting such an enterprise.
